What Does “Rent Burdened” Mean? How Much Rent Is Too Much

Learn the official definition (spending 30% or more of your gross income on housing) and how to calculate your exact rent-to-income ratio. This guide offers expert tips on factoring in total housing costs (including utilities and fees) and budgeting accurately to avoid unnecessary financial strain.

University, Bozeman, MT Local Guide

Cheapest Available University Apartments for Rent

 

The cheapest available apartment rental in the University area of Bozeman, MT is a 4 Beds unit found at boötes priced from $1,115. 801 W Villard St has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$1,300. Here are the most affordable University apartments for rent in Bozeman, MT:

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ap University Apartments

What is the Cheapest Studio apartment in University?

Currently the most affordable Cheap Studio Apartment in University is at Silver Creek Apartments listed at $1,595.

How much is rent for a Cheap One Bedroom University Apartment?

The lowest price for a Cheap One Bedroom University Apartment is $1,300 at 801 W Villard St.

What is the lowest price for a Cheap Two Bedroom University Apartment for rent?

Today's best deal for a Cheap Two Bedroom Apartment in University is starting from $1,415 at boötes.

What is the most affordable University Three Bedroom Apartment?

The best deal on a cheap University Three Bedroom Apartment rental is at boötes and starts from $1,285.
